|
发表于 2005-1-8 13:05:12
|
显示全部楼层
grep string *
会将当前文件中包含字符tring的行打印出来,最前面是文件名加冒号
如:
$grep "awk" *
test:if [ `df /dev/hda1|awk '{print $5}'|sed -n '/[0-9\{1,3\}]/p'|sed 's/%//'` -ge 90 ]
加选项-n可列出文件名和在此文件中的行号
$grep -n "awk" *
test:1:if [ `df /dev/hda1|awk '{print $5}'|sed -n '/[0-9\{1,3\}]/p'|sed 's/%//'` -ge 90 ] |
|